Transaction 8ca94665e03863a2fae5d9314c7844ca0e30a33a8c6a1e56f9df8cf6c83f505a
1 Input
1 Output
-
8ca94665e03863a2fae5d9314c7844ca0e30a33a8c6a1e56f9df8cf6c83f505a:0
- value
- 10390400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fce59505d81091f213115c76459c4fd942f5f9aa OP_EQUAL
- address
- 3QkDEXiWbowcuY5g8WhEFmhLrsVUDoGQf5